Chez Leon
Permanently closed
7927 Forsyth Blvd
Saint Louis, MO 63105
Chez Leon, a beloved French restaurant in Saint Louis, has been delighting the local community for over a decade with its blend of authentic, traditional, and contemporary cuisine.
Voted "Best French" and "Most Romantic" by multiple St. Louis publications, Chez Leon offers a full wine list, a three-course prixe fixe menu, and live piano entertainment every Sunday by Craig Cervantes.
Generated from their available business information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.